The Java 2 Platform, Micro Edition (J2ME) FAQ addresses the vast space of networked consumer and embedded devices, from smart cards, pagers, and mobile phones, to set-top boxes and automobile navigation systems. This FAQ also addresses technologies used to connect J2ME-enabled devices to consumer and enterprise services, including standard wireless data formats (WML, Compact HTML, and XHTML) and protocols (most importantly, HTTP/HTTPS and the WAP protocol stack).
